Division Chief of Administrative Services The City of Alexandria is located in northern Virginia and is bordered by the District of Columbia (Potomac River), Arlington and Fairfax counties. With a population of approximately 150,000 and a land area of 15.75 square miles, Alexandria is the seventh largest city in the Commonwealth of Virginia. Alexandria has a vibrant waterfront and is a unique and historic place to live and work. About one-quarter of the City’s square miles have been designated as a national or local historic district. An Overview The City of Alexandria’s Finance Department is looking for an innovative, collaborative, and detail-oriented Division Chief for Administrative Services to join our team. The Division Chief for Administrative Services manages all administrative and support functions in the Finance Department and supervises the Administration Division. The incumbent is responsible for the department’s budget development and monitoring, accounts payable, purchasing, property and facility management, information technology, human resources, and communications. The Division Chief will lead the department in fostering a culture of respect, continuous improvement, teamwork, integrity, and employee engagement. The Division Chief for Administrative Services works under the general supervision of the Deputy Finance Director. The Opportunity – Examples of Work Directs, manages, and supervises Admin division staff, establishing priorities and ensuring strategic goals, program objectives, and operational outcomes are achieved; Oversees the department's fiscal administration, including budget development and monitoring, accounts payable, contract administration, procurement coordination, and financial reporting to ensure sound fiscal stewardship and compliance with City policies; Leads and coordinates the department's human resources management functions, including recruitment, onboarding and offboarding, employee relations, personnel actions, timekeeping, performance management, and learning and development (performing some of these duties directly and supervising staff in the performance of others); Conducts research on personnel and organizational issues, prepares reports, formulates policy recommendations, and identifies training opportunities that support employee development, succession planning, and career advancement; Coordinates initiatives that enhance employee engagement, organizational culture, and professional development while ensuring departmental values are reflected in daily operations; Provides strategic leadership for the department's internal and external communications, including oversight of the department's public-facing website, City intranet content, and digital communication strategies to ensure information is accurate, accessible, and timely; Leads the department's technology modernization efforts, including implementation and governance of Microsoft 365, SharePoint, and other collaboration platforms to improve business processes, document management, knowledge sharing, and operational efficiency; Leads the development and implementation of city-wide training and policy guidance for fiscal managers on fundamental financial management principles and practices; Partners with the department's Risk Management and Safety staff to advance workplace safety initiatives, support regulatory compliance, implement risk mitigation strategies, and promote a culture of safety throughout the department; Provides analytical and strategic support to the Deputy Finance Director and Finance Director in preparing reports, presentations, and recommendations for the City Manager and City Council regarding the City's financial management, departmental initiatives, and supplemental budget appropriation ordinances; Represents the department on cross-functional teams, committees, and special projects, advancing organizational priorities and improving service delivery; Performs related work as required. About the Department The City of Alexandria's Finance Department is a fast-paced, diverse, and customer service focused operation that is responsible for the assessment, collection, and enforcement of all City taxes, the management of cash flow and investments, accounting for and reporting the City’s financial position, processing payroll, executing a fair and competitive procurement environment, assessing all real and personal property in the City, managing the City’s risk and safety programs, and managing the City’s pension plans. The Finance Department has seven divisions and in fiscal year 2027 is operating with a total budget of $16.6 million and 107 FTE positions.
